Induction motor, also called "asynchronous motor", is a device that places the rotor in a rotating magnetic field, obtains a rotational torque under the action of the rotating magnetic field, and thus rotates the rotor. A rotor is a rotatable conductor, usually in the shape of a squirrel cage. Invented by electrical engineer Nikola Tesla in 1887. Asynchronous features
1. Generally speaking, small asynchronous motors refer to induction operated asynchronous motors. This type of motor not only uses auxiliary coils and capacitors during startup, but also during operation. Although the starting torque is not very high, its structure is simple, reliable, and efficient.
2. The rated speed of the motor will also change with the size of the load.
3. Can operate continuously.
4. Used in applications that do not require speed braking.
5. Use E insulation levels, while UL motors use A levels.
6. There are two types of induction transformation: single-phase asynchronous motors and three-phase asynchronous motors.
7. Single phase motors are induction operated asynchronous motors with high efficiency and low noise.
8. When a single-phase asynchronous motor operates, it generates a torque opposite to the direction of rotation, so it is impossible to change direction in a short period of time. The rotation direction of the motor should be changed after it has completely stopped.
